In 2026 we will be serving at the Boardwalk Chapel during a normal Youth Group week, as opposed to 2025 when we attended an evangelism training week in which individuals from many different churches were welcomed to attend. This means that the training is more condensed, the programs (music, a few 5-minute sermons, and gospel presentation skits) are on every weekday (including on Wednesday when we run a program on our own without the Chapel staff), and the evangelism nights go later into the night. Accommodation 

BWC: Bunks at the Boardwalk Chapel

We will have the BWC itself to ourselves, which has 20+ beds, a newly renovated kitchen, and three full baths with showers.

Costs

Per-person cost: $450, but we hope to fundraise for as much of this as possible. Scholarships also may be possible.

Fundraising

Because our attendees will be joining us from several churches, centralized fundraising events won’t be feasible, so please begin independent efforts according to your own needs.

Lord’s Day Observance

The OPC church nearest to the BWC which is most closely associated with their operations is Christ the King Presbyterian. This is a only Psalm singing congregation which meets for worship at 10:30am at their building on the north side of the island. On Sunday evening, our group will attend the service held at the BWC.
